I'm starting to get a little worried that the fans (not the team or coaches) are taking the Buff's too lightly.  Not that it really matters what the fans think, except for the quality of discourse in the game threads and liveblog.

I've only watched the Colorado v. CSU game so far, but they look like an honest to goodness P5 team.  Their QB is a senior that has a lot of experience and was good at making his reads.  They run a spread tempo, and I hate playing tempo teams (too much trauma from the Carr/Hoke days).  

We'll probably dominate on both lines, but they've got a lot of good players. 

Both of their #4's look like solid athletes.  #4 on Defense has good ball instincts and breaks on the ball well.  #4 on Offense is a good blocking WR in addition to being a deep threat.  I am very worried about him blocking Clark who had a bad day getting off blocks against UCF.
